“Demon Slayer: Kimetsu no Yaiba” New Visual & PV Released! Zenitsu vs. Kaigaku: ‘Our paths have diverged’

The fifth key visual and promotional video for the upcoming film Demon Slayer: Kimetsu no Yaiba - Infinity Castle Arc Part 1: The Return of Akaza have been released, featuring Zenitsu Agatsuma and Upper Rank demon Kaigaku under the tagline “Our paths have diverged.”

Based on Koyoharu Gotouge’s hit manga serialized in Weekly Shonen Jump from February 2016 to May 2020, Demon Slayer is set in Japan’s Taisho era, where demons prey on humans. The story follows Tanjiro Kamado, a boy whose family is slaughtered by demons, and his journey to join the Demon Slayer Corps in order to turn his demonized sister Nezuko back into a human and avenge his family. The manga has surpassed 220 million copies in circulation worldwide.

The anime adaptation began in April 2019 with the Unwavering Resolve Arc, followed by the record-shattering Mugen Train movie in October 2020, which grossed approximately ¥51.7 billion ($351.7 million) worldwide. Subsequent arcs include Entertainment District Arc (2021), Swordsmith Village Arc (2023), and Hashira Training Arc (2024). The ongoing Infinity Castle Arc is being produced as a trilogy, with Akaza Returns depicting the Demon Slayer Corps’ final battle against Muzan Kibutsuji and the Upper Rank Demons within the Infinity Castle.
